What does top 3 protected draft pick mean?

What does top 3 protected draft pick mean?

The pick is top-three protected in 2021, meaning the Timberwolves keep it if they earn a top-three pick. If their pick falls outside of the top three, however, it goes to the Warriors. Golden State might prefer to have Minnesota’s unprotected pick next season, but the 2021 NBA Draft isn’t exactly short on talent.

What is a protected first-round pick in basketball?

what is a protected pick? • r/nba – basically, if the draft pick for example ends up being in the top 5 of the 1st round due to the draft lottery, then the team trading away the pick instead keeps it and gives up one the next year.

Can you trade consecutive first-round picks NBA?

The NBA thereafter instituted the “Stepien Rule,” which states that a team (usually) cannot trade its first-round pick in consecutive years.

How do drafts work?

In a draft, teams take turns selecting from a pool of eligible players. When a team selects a player, the team receives exclusive rights to sign that player to a contract, and no other team in the league may sign the player. They also require minimum and sometimes maximum salaries for newly drafted players.

Why Does NBA have draft lottery?

After the 1984 coin flip, which was won by the Houston Rockets, the NBA introduced the lottery system to counter the accusations that the Rockets and several other teams were deliberately losing their regular season games in order to secure the worst record and consequently the chance to obtain the first pick.

Does every NBA team get a draft pick?

Each NBA team gets one selection in the first round and one selection in the second round.

How do NBA draft picks work?

A machine picks four balls at a time, and every possible combination of numbers is assigned to a team. Teams with worse records get more combinations of numbers, which means that they have a better chance to win. The machine picks three teams, and these teams get the first three picks in the draft.

What does swap worst mean?

Swap Best basically means that, when you take their pick in a trade, whichever pick, either theirs or yours, turns out to be higher in the draft right after the lottery selection goes to you. Swap worst means that you receive the worst.

Do all draft picks get signed NBA?

The NBA’s rookie-scale structure dictates that first-rounders will be signed to four-year deals, which include two guaranteed years, then team options in years three and four. Teams can sign second-rounders to whatever amount they choose, using cap room or various exceptions.

What does a protected pick mean in the NBA?

A protected pick is a pick which has been traded, but only if a certain set of criteria are met. For instance, if a pick is top-10 protected, that means the team who originally owned the pick gets to keep it if the pick ends up being in the top 10.

How do protected picks work?

Protected picks mean that a pick is traded with the condition that it does not fall within the protected range for a given year. If it does fall within the protected range, the pick will not be traded, and instead a different pick (in a future year or the 2nd round) will be sent instead.
